Effective July 1, 2025, Colorado’s Privacy Act expands to impose obligations on any organization handling biometric
identifiers or biometric data, even if previously exempt. Required actions include clear prior notice, informed consent, a
public written policy with retention, deletion, and incident-response guidelines, along with strict deletion timelines and
restrictions on sale, purchase, or dissemination. The amendments also extend limited biometric privacy protections to
employees and job applicants.
